Output 8043aae5acc33f6d2c804933e3fe6d3b0075c4421728d0a9fb2b36805fb917fc:1

value
1042643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6c2dc3f2b784ca81dedfe775932726c89ec74c OP_EQUAL
address
3BPj9GeTLXQ5F2Cm5SCMZmYiTAHhAqY2u7
transaction
8043aae5acc33f6d2c804933e3fe6d3b0075c4421728d0a9fb2b36805fb917fc
spent
true